Cognitive Diversity and Innovation

Meaning ● Cognitive Diversity and Innovation, within the scope of Small and Medium-sized Businesses (SMBs), signifies the strategic integration of varied thought processes and problem-solving approaches to stimulate inventive solutions and boost operational efficiency. For SMB growth, this includes leveraging employees’ unique perspectives and backgrounds to identify market gaps and develop differentiated products or services. Automation efforts benefit through improved system design and user experience by considering diverse user needs and preferences. ● Implementation phases require that businesses must actively encourage open dialogues, ensuring that various voices contribute to decision-making, and prevent groupthink scenarios. This method fosters an agile SMB environment primed for swift innovation adoption and adaptation to evolving market demands. A company’s diverse cognitive resources directly influence its innovation output, which consequently affects its competitiveness and profitability.
